To study the mechanism of decreased endothelium-dependent relaxations in
spontaneously hypertensive rats (SHR), rings of thoracic aorta with and
without endothelium were taken from age-matched male SHR and normotensive
Wistar-Kyoto rats (WKY) and suspended for isometric tension recording.
Acetylcholine caused endothelium-dependent contractions in quiescent rings
from SHR but not in those from WKY. These contractions were inhibited by
atropine but not by hexamethonium and were prevented by inhibitors of
phospholipase A2 or cyclooxygenase but not by inhibitors of prostacyclin
synthetase, thromboxane synthetase, or leukotriene synthetase.
Prostaglandin D2, E1, E2, and F2 alpha caused concentration-dependent
contractions in rings without endothelium from both SHR and WKY; the
responses to the highest concentration (10(-5) M) of the individual
prostaglandins were comparable in both strains. Endothelium-dependent
relaxations evoked by high but not by low concentrations of acetylcholine
were significantly depressed in SHR as compared with those in WKY (p less
than 0.05). Indomethacin normalized endothelium-dependent relaxations in
SHR. Thus, acetylcholine can activate muscarinic receptors that evoke
endothelium- dependent contractions in the aorta of SHR but not in that of
WKY. The contraction probably is mediated by a cyclooxygenase product(s)
other than prostacyclin or thromboxane A2. The reduced
endothelium-dependent relaxations to acetylcholine in the SHR probably are
not due to a decreased release of endothelium-derived relaxing factor(s)
but to the simultaneous release of endothelium-derived contracting
substance(s).
